Biology: Exploring the Fascinating World of Life

Biology is the study of life and living organisms, encompassing various branches that delve into different aspects of life. This field of science is vast and diverse, with numerous subtopics that allow us to understand the world around us. In this article, we will explore three key subtopics within biology: physiology, genetics, and cell biology.

Physiology

Physiology is the study of the functions and mechanisms that maintain life within living organisms. It involves the understanding of the internal workings of living organisms, including their metabolic processes, growth and development, and responses to external stimuli. Physiology helps us understand how various systems within an organism work together to maintain homeostasis, or the balance of bodily functions. This knowledge is crucial for understanding human health and disease, as well as for developing effective treatments.

Genetics

Genetics is the study of heredity and the variation of inherited traits in a population. It involves the analysis of genes, their function, and how they are passed down from one generation to the next. Genetics helps us understand the mechanisms behind inherited traits, how mutations occur, and how genetic materials control the growth and development of organisms. This field has been instrumental in understanding the causes of many genetic disorders and has led to advancements in genetic engineering and gene therapy.

Cell Biology

Cell biology is the study of the structure, function, and behavior of cells, which are the fundamental units of life. It encompasses various aspects of cell structure, including the cell membrane, cytoskeleton, and organelles. Cell biology also explores the processes that occur within cells, such as cell division, metabolism, and cell signaling. This knowledge is vital for understanding the growth and development of organisms, as well as for developing treatments for various diseases.
